Опис DES Довжина ключа дорівнює 56 бітам . (Ключ зазвичай подається 64-бітовим числом, але кожен восьмий біт використовується для перевірки парності та ігнорується. Біти парності є найменшими значущими бітами байтів ключа). Ключ, який може бути будь-яким 56-бітовим числом, можна змінити в будь-який момент часу.
Нині основним недоліком DES вважають маленьку довжину ключа, тому вже давно почали розробляти різні альтернативи цьому алгоритму шифрування.
DES (англ. Data Encryption Standard) – алгоритм для симетричного шифрування, розроблений фірмою IBM і затверджений урядом США 1977 року як офіційний стандарт (FIPS 46-3). Розмір блоку для DES дорівнює 64 бітам. В основі алгоритму лежить мережа Фейстеля з 16 циклами (раундами) і ключем, що має довжину 56 біт.
DES має блоки по 64 біт і 16 циклову структуру мережі Фейстеля, для шифрування використовує ключ з довжиною 56 біт (у перетворенні беруть участь раундові ключі по 48 біт).